Why is it class A ships are the best?
So far I have yet to see any trend that would put class B or C ships above class A. Class A ships seem to have the most reactor power to spare, the highest top speed, the fastest shield recovery. It's true that they can't mount the most powerful weapons, and their shields have a small disadvantage in capacity, but with the ability to keep more systems fully powered, it really looks to me like class A ships are the best overall.

Am I wrong?

Deadoon Sep 17, 2023 @ 12:50pm 
Class C reactors have higher max outputs, provide more hull durability to them, can handle the most powerful class C weapons, and the highest output grav drives, which have 50 thrust.

Also you can use Class A thrusters on a Class C ship to get the higher max speed if you wanted.

Technically the best balanced shield imo is a class B one with 1500 shields.

Yeah, ship unlocks go all the way to level 60.

Class C ships can use thrusters like the Sal 6830, which is a quest reward unlock I learned recently(and was able to purchase, but not use at like level 20 on this run), which has a whopping 18000 thrust, and 8800 maneuver for only 2 engine power. These allow you to make some pretty high capacity and efficiency ships with the only sacrifice being a loss of 13% max speed.
